A PAIR OF FRENCH ORMOLU-MOUNTED MAHOGANY GUERIDONS
OF RECENT MANUFACTURE, AFTER THE MODEL BY ADAM WEISWEILER
Each with a circular red and yellow-veined breccia mottled marble top above three pairs of simulated bambo supports joined by a tripartite stretcher surmounted by a circular dish and terminating in folate cast feet
29¾ in. (76.5 cm.) high; 20¾ in. (52.5 cm.) diameter (2)

Specialist note

The model for this pair of gueridons was first executed by Adam Weisweiler maître March 26 1778, illustrated in P. Kjellberg, Le Mobilier Français du XVIII Siècle, 1998, p. 868, fig. A.
